package com.oracle.bmc.dataintegration.model;

/**
 * A rule to define the set of fields to sort by, and whether to sort by ascending or descending values.
 * 
* Note: Objects should always be created or deserialized using the {@link Builder}. This model distinguishes fields * that are {@code null} because they are unset from fields that are explicitly set to {@code null}. This is done in * the setter methods of the {@link Builder}, which maintain a set of all explicitly set fields called * {@link #__explicitlySet__}. The {@link #hashCode()} and {@link #equals(Object)} methods are implemented to take * {@link #__explicitlySet__} into account. The constructor, on the other hand, does not set {@link #__explicitlySet__} * (since the constructor cannot distinguish explicit {@code null} from unset {@code null}). **/ @javax.annotation.Generated(value = "OracleSDKGenerator", comments = "API Version: 20200430") @com.fasterxml.jackson.databind.annotation.JsonDeserialize(builder = SortKeyRule.Builder.class) @com.fasterxml.jackson.annotation.JsonFilter(com.oracle.bmc.http.internal.ExplicitlySetFilter.NAME) public final class SortKeyRule extends com.oracle.bmc.http.internal.ExplicitlySetBmcModel { @Deprecated @java.beans.ConstructorProperties({"wrappedRule", "isAscending"}) public SortKeyRule(ProjectionRule wrappedRule, Boolean isAscending) { super(); this.wrappedRule = wrappedRule; this.isAscending = isAscending; } @com.fasterxml.jackson.databind.annotation.JsonPOJOBuilder(withPrefix = "") public static class Builder { @com.fasterxml.jackson.annotation.JsonProperty("wrappedRule") private ProjectionRule wrappedRule; public Builder wrappedRule(ProjectionRule wrappedRule) { this.wrappedRule = wrappedRule; this.__explicitlySet__.add("wrappedRule"); return this; } /** * Specifies if the sort key has ascending order. **/ @com.fasterxml.jackson.annotation.JsonProperty("isAscending") private Boolean isAscending; /** * Specifies if the sort key has ascending order. * @param isAscending the value to set * @return this builder **/ public Builder isAscending(Boolean isAscending) { this.isAscending = isAscending; this.__explicitlySet__.add("isAscending"); return this; } @com.fasterxml.jackson.annotation.JsonIgnore private final java.util.Set __explicitlySet__ = new java.util.HashSet(); public SortKeyRule build() { SortKeyRule model = new SortKeyRule(this.wrappedRule, this.isAscending); for (String explicitlySetProperty : this.__explicitlySet__) { model.markPropertyAsExplicitlySet(explicitlySetProperty); } return model; } @com.fasterxml.jackson.annotation.JsonIgnore public Builder copy(SortKeyRule model) { if (model.wasPropertyExplicitlySet("wrappedRule")) { this.wrappedRule(model.getWrappedRule()); } if (model.wasPropertyExplicitlySet("isAscending")) { this.isAscending(model.getIsAscending()); } return this; } } /** * Create a new builder. */ public static Builder builder() { return new Builder(); } public Builder toBuilder() { return new Builder().copy(this); } @com.fasterxml.jackson.annotation.JsonProperty("wrappedRule") private final ProjectionRule wrappedRule; public ProjectionRule getWrappedRule() { return wrappedRule; } /** * Specifies if the sort key has ascending order. **/ @com.fasterxml.jackson.annotation.JsonProperty("isAscending") private final Boolean isAscending; /** * Specifies if the sort key has ascending order. * @return the value **/ public Boolean getIsAscending() { return isAscending; } @Override public String toString() { return this.toString(true); } /** * Return a string representation of the object. * @param includeByteArrayContents true to include the full contents of byte arrays * @return string representation */ public String toString(boolean includeByteArrayContents) { java.lang.StringBuilder sb = new java.lang.StringBuilder(); sb.append("SortKeyRule("); sb.append("super=").append(super.toString()); sb.append("wrappedRule=").append(String.valueOf(this.wrappedRule)); sb.append(", isAscending=").append(String.valueOf(this.isAscending)); sb.append(")"); return sb.toString(); } @Override public boolean equals(Object o) { if (this == o) { return true; } if (!(o instanceof SortKeyRule)) { return false; } SortKeyRule other = (SortKeyRule) o; return java.util.Objects.equals(this.wrappedRule, other.wrappedRule) && java.util.Objects.equals(this.isAscending, other.isAscending) && super.equals(other); } @Override public int hashCode() { final int PRIME = 59; int result = 1; result = (result * PRIME) + (this.wrappedRule == null ? 43 : this.wrappedRule.hashCode()); result = (result * PRIME) + (this.isAscending == null ? 43 : this.isAscending.hashCode()); result = (result * PRIME) + super.hashCode(); return result; } }
